Frederick G. "Fritz" Pentico, 82 of Angola died Saturday, July 24, 2010 at his home. Mr. Pentico was a truck driver for Ramus Truck Lines and then Gateway Trucking for a total of 40 years. Then he worked on the Indiana Toll Road as a toll collector, retiring in 1990. He was a member of the Angola Moose Lodge; American Legion Post 31, Angola; George Anspaugh VFW post 7205; Angola Masonic Lodge 236 and Scottish Rite, Valley of Fort Wayne. He was a veteran of the U.S. Navy. He was born March 3, 1928, Ann Arbor, Mich. to Orville G. and Nina E. (Buffet) Pentico, who preceded him in death. He married Bonnie Jean Hufnagle on Dec. 23, 1951. She preceded him in death in 1989. Surviving are a son, John E. Pentico of Angola; two daughters and a son-in-law, Janet and Jon Weber of Fremont and Linda Pentico of Angola; two brothers, Orville Pentico Jr. of Crocker, Mo., and James Pentico of Hamilton; a sister, Margaret Mills of Fort Wayne; three grandchildren; five great-grandchildren; and his companion, Carol Disbro of Edon, Ohio.
